Automation
All of the 3 availability services, EqualWeb, AudioEye, and AccessiBe, have a distinct place for automation in their ease of access service package. At EqualWeb, accessibility audit is a totally free service and is dealt with by Google Chrome software application specifically devoted to that purpose. With AudioEye, you can count on the free Builder Chrome extension to direct you on repairing available mistakes on your site after you might have run an automated WCAG screening. While AccessiBe, through its free availability scanning platform, aCe, also offers an equal procedure of automation to begin the compliance journey.
Manual Accessibility
EqualWeb is a totally hybrid ease of access service with arrangements for both extremes of automation and handbook availability. Called site accessibility audit of your website content, structure, and style design templates at a customized charge. Equalweb Script
AudioEye, by the same token, provides an adequate option to automated software application in its Managed strategy. AudioEye’s Managed strategy not just provides you access to its innovative ease of access toolbar however likewise employs the help of AudioEye’s specialist group to perform the audit and removal of your website. Put simply, it is a do-it-for-me choice.
You would recall that AccessiBe is a completely automated availability option. Hence, from the very start, AccessiBe may find it hard to complete with EqualWeb and AudioEye which are both hybrid options.

EqualWeb Pricing
EqualWeb uses a mouth-watering complimentary strategy that consists of close to half of the functions on a typical accessibility toolbar. It makes it possible to perform an automatic assessment of the site as well as delight in fundamental tools in the accessibility widget.
For its Availability Tracking, which is more of a handled plan that gets the know-how of EqualWeb’s availability team, the price starts at $590 each year for a standard site of up 100 pages and could cost as much as $9990 per year (manual) accessibility monitoring of up 100,000 pages.
